The long-term effects of exposure to low doses of lead in childhood. An 11-year follow-up report.

TL;DR: Exposure to lead in childhood is associated with deficits in central nervous system functioning that persist into young adulthood, and lead levels were inversely related to self-reports of minor delinquent activity.

Protection against tissue damage in vivo by desferrioxamine: what is its mechanism of action?

TL;DR: Desferrioxamine (deferoxamine) is an inhibitor of iron-dependent free radical reactions that has been used to investigate the role of such reactions in several animal model systems for human disease as mentioned in this paper.
